This is the dramatic moment flash floods tore through New York City, turning streets into rivers after torrential rain battered the area

The chaos unfolded on Monday, July 14, 2025 when nearly two inches of rain fell in just 30 minutes - the city's second-highest hourly rainfall total since 1943.

Footage filmed at 90th Street and East End Avenue shows water gushing down the road, overtaking pavements and forcing pedestrians to wade through rising floodwater.

Another video captured a gas station completely submerged, with water pooling around the pumps.

The downpour quickly overwhelmed drainage systems, flooding streets, subways, and major roads across all five boroughs.

Several subway lines were suspended as stations filled with water.
